Transaction 40256bbc8c2fca13e2214ee54b649a164efcd8666b132f470021f8ade344aaa4

1 Input
2 Outputs
  • 40256bbc8c2fca13e2214ee54b649a164efcd8666b132f470021f8ade344aaa4:0
  • value  592449
    address  32XfC1w6yZsLAASKqW85hnKn2GtUVtrNQQ
  • 40256bbc8c2fca13e2214ee54b649a164efcd8666b132f470021f8ade344aaa4:1
  • value  34595765
    address  3M3h1TBL4b9QR68P3adD2fwFTpfTFuQaKB